Tl; Dr.

  • One of the first companies to build an XRP strategic reserve has chosen to use RLUSD payments for his subsidiary of electric vehicles instead of Ripple’s Native Non-StableCoin token.
  • The company said that the Stablecoin option will speed up transactions and reduce costs at the same time.

Vivopower International PLC announced The relocation on 8 September, which indicates that his EV daughter-Tembo e-LV-IS started accepting payments in Ripple’s Stablecoin, RLUSD, which was launched less than a year ago.

Tembo describes itself as a company that is looking for practical solutions for real-life challenges that influence conventional international wire transfers, including longer waiting periods and high transaction costs.

The explanation is that RLUSD makes it possible for international wire transfers to be completed “almost immediately” with a “fraction of the costs” of conventional. The Stablecoin also provides security to users because it is 1: 1 linked to the US dollar and is fully supported by Greenback deposits, short-term American treasury and other kasequivalents.

According to the announcement, the expected benefits of trusting RLUSD instead of traditional wire transfers will be as follows:

  • Improve efficiency: Acceleration of transactions, especially for international customers and partners.
  • Pay the costs: Lower costs and delays related to traditional bank channels and Fiat -Maluta.
  • Support Innovation: Promote the approval of digital assets on Enterprise that meet strict compliance and audit standards.
  • Expand Treasury options: Broaden the digital assets and decentralized finance (Defi) strategy of the company.

The relocation, which was also announced on X, led to a few questions from users about why the company only chose the Stablecoin and left Ripple’s much more popular and larger in the market capital – XRP – out of screen.

Although the statement does not tackle this, the most likely reason is probably related to the lack of price fluctuations against traditional options such as the USD. Both assets work as cross -border tokens, but RLUSD maintains its value against the greenback, while XRP can be very volatile.

Nevertheless, Vivopower, who said it is “a strategic transformation undergoes in the world’s first XRP-oriented digital asset company,” has already started to collect it actively. Earlier this month it made a purchase of $ 30 million and is planning to expand that number to $ 200 million in XRP.
